Technical Field
The utility model relates to a relevant technical field of building materials machinery specifically is a spray set is used in building materials machinery production.
Background
The spraying device required in the production process of the building material machine can realize the effect of cooling in the use and production of the machine, and is used for achieving the maintenance of the building material machine and improving the environment of use and production.
However, the existing spray device has the following disadvantages: the spray set that uses in the work of loop wheel machine is portable and external device, needs operating personnel to take out the shower and installs on the loop wheel machine device in addition, and this process can cause serious wearing and tearing to the shower, has reduced the life of shower for the scrapping of shower has increased the consumption of building materials goods and materials consequently.

Detailed Description
The technical solution in the embodiments of the present invention will be clearly and completely described below with reference to the accompanying drawings in the embodiments of the present invention.
As shown in fig. 1-5, the utility model provides a technical solution: a spray set for production of building material machinery, comprising: the cleaning device comprises a crane spraying base 1, a spray pipe rotary drum 4, guide rails 7 and a cleaning cylinder 9, wherein rotary drum supports 3 are fixedly welded at two ends of the upper surface of the crane spraying base 1, the rotary drum supports 3 are used for fixing and realizing the effect of the rotatable spray pipe rotary drum 4, two ends of the spray pipe rotary drum 4 are fixedly connected to the top ends of the two rotary drum supports 3 in a switching manner, rotating wheels 5 are fixedly welded at two ends of the side surface of the spray pipe rotary drum 4, an operator can control the rotating wheels 5 to realize the effect of rotating the spray pipe rotary drum 4 so as to achieve the lower effect of adjusting the length of the spray pipe 6, the spray pipe 6 is fixedly connected to the side surface of the spray pipe rotary drum 4 in a switching manner, the guide rails 7 are fixedly welded at one side of the upper surface of the crane spraying base 1, a cleaning cylinder rotary frame 8 is movably installed inside the guide, the rotating blocks 10 assist in realizing the effect of adjusting the angle of the cleaning cylinder 9, the two rotating blocks 10 are fixedly and rotatably connected inside the top ends of the two walls of the cleaning cylinder rotating frame 8, a wiping cylinder 14 is movably arranged at one side of the cleaning cylinder 9 close to the spray pipe rotating cylinder 4, an impurity removing cylinder 15 is movably arranged at one side of the cleaning cylinder 9 far away from the spray pipe rotating cylinder 4, two first guide grooves 12 are fixedly arranged on one side of the inner surface of the cleaning cylinder 9 far away from the spray pipe rotating cylinder 4, two second guide grooves 13 are fixedly arranged on one side of the inner surface of the cleaning cylinder 9 far away from the spray pipe rotating cylinder 4, two first installation blocks 18 are fixedly welded on the side surface of the wiping cylinder 14, two second installation blocks 19 are fixedly welded on the side surface of the impurity removing cylinder 15, the two first installation blocks 18 are respectively movably installed in the two first guide grooves 12, and the two second installation blocks 19 are respectively movably installed in the two second guide grooves 13.
The inner surface of the cleaning barrel 9 is fixedly provided with two first mounting grooves communicated with the first guide groove 12, the two first mounting blocks 18 are respectively and movably mounted inside the two first mounting grooves, the wiping barrel 14 is mounted inside the cleaning barrel 9 along the first guide groove 12, and then the first mounting blocks 18 are rotated to enter the first mounting grooves to complete the mounting of the wiping barrel 14.
Two second mounting grooves 20 communicated with the second guide groove 13 are fixedly formed in the inner surface of the cleaning barrel 9, the second mounting blocks 19 are movably mounted inside the two second mounting grooves 20 respectively, the impurity removing barrel 15 is mounted inside the cleaning barrel 9 along the second guide groove 13, and then the second mounting blocks 19 rotate to enter the second mounting grooves 20 to complete mounting of the impurity removing barrel 15.
A cleaning cloth layer 16 is fixedly arranged on the inner surface of the wiping cylinder 14, and the cleaning cloth layer 16 is used for cleaning dust on the side surface of the spray pipe 6 and deeply cleaning the surface of the spray pipe 6 to provide a maintenance effect.
An impurity removal brush 17 is fixedly mounted on the inner surface of the impurity removal barrel 15, and the impurity removal brush 17 is used for removing stones and impurities attached to the side surface of the spray pipe 6 and is used for preliminarily cleaning the impurities on the surface of the spray pipe 6 to avoid damaging the surface of the spray pipe 6.
Four shifting rings 2 are fixedly welded on the upper surface of the crane spraying base 1, and the shifting rings 2 are used for providing connecting parts for moving the crane spraying base 1.
The other end of the spray pipe 6 penetrates through the cleaning barrel 9 and is fixedly provided with a spray head 11, and the spray head 11 is used for increasing the area sprayed by water flow.
